The Acu-Trac® Smart 485 family ultrasonic liquid level transducers are designed for continuous level monitoring and liquid level control applications. These non-contact continuous level transducers can monitor tanks or storage containers that have a depth of up to 1.9 meters (75.69 inches) for gasoline and 2.5 meters (98.4 inches) for other media. The Acu-Trac® Smart 485 ultrasonic transducers incorporate a RS-485 bus for real time processing of liquid levels in two messaging formats. The Smart 485 liquid level transducers offers three electrical outputs for level control in the following forms:
4-20 mA Current (12V or 24V input)
Ratiometric Voltage 0.5 to 9.0 Volt (12V input)
Non-Ratiometric 0.5 to 9.5 Volt (24 Volt input).
The Smart 485 liquid level transducer is designed with power up self diagnostics and allows the user flexibility through programmable features:
Tank Configuration Profiling
Digital Filtering
Gauge Drive Output (full and empty endpoints)
Communication Mode.
Note: An Acu-Trac® Smart 485 Configuration Kit is required to program the liquid level transducer.
Accuracy: 2 % full scale of tank volume
Reliability: Acu-Trac® Smart 485 liquid level transducers are non-contacting. Resistive float senders have a wiper that slides across a resistive strip that with time can wear out and cause intermittent or complete loss of the signal.
Non-Invasive: Acu-Trac® Smart 485 mounts to the same opening as the resistive float sender, but does not protrude into the tank.
Digital Filtering: User programmable time constant in digital filtering eliminates errors due to fluids sloshing in mobile tanks.
Tank Profiling: User programmable strapping tables for unique tank shapes.
Chemical compatibility: Acu-Trac® Smart 485 works with a wide variety of media including diesel, gasoline, motor oil, hydraulic fluid, black water, and more.
Self Test/Diagnostics: Internal Power Up Test verifies transducer is operating properly.
Continuous Real Time Liquid Level Monitoring: Electrical output and RS-485 messaging data.
RS-485 Messaging: Two types of messages – programming commands and timed data broadcast messages. (See AT-AN14 for more details)
NEMA 4 Rating
